An electric fence charger, often called an energizer, converts AC or DC power into high-voltage pulses sent through the fence wire. When an animal touches the wire, the circuit completes through its body to the soil, delivering a brief shock that trains the animal to stay away. The size of that shock depends on the joule output, the fence length, the vegetation load, and crucially, how well you ground the system.

After three months on our test line, the Zareba EAC50M-Z is the unit I trust with our 35-acre rotational pasture. The 2.0 joule output delivered a measured 6,800 volts at the far end of our fence even with grass touching the wire, which is where smaller chargers lose their punch. This is the model I recommend to anyone running cattle, horses, or goats on more than 10 acres.
The low-impedance design is the headline feature. Where older chargers bled voltage into the soil the moment weeds touched the wire, the Zareba 50 Mile kept the pulse strong. I watched our fence tester stay above 5,000 volts through a week of growth, and the cattle respected it on contact.

What surprised me most was the warranty. Zareba backs this unit for two years out of the box and three years with registration, and that includes lightning damage. Our neighbor lost a cheaper charger in the same July storm that this one survived, and Zareba honored his claim within two weeks. That is rare in this category.
Real-World Mileage vs Marketing Claims
The 50-mile rating is an ideal-condition number, and Zareba rates it at 12 miles in heavy weeds and 25 miles in light weeds. In our test, we saw consistent performance up to about 18 miles of single-strand fence with moderate grass contact, which is right in line with the real-world range. If your fence is in the 20-30 mile range with light vegetation, this is the right size. If you are below 10 miles, you are paying for capacity you will not use.
Joule Output and Animal Type
The 2.0 joule output sits in the sweet spot for most livestock work. It is more than enough for cattle, horses, and pigs. For goat and sheep fencing, where animals challenge the fence more, the headroom matters because a charger at its limit will lose voltage to every weed. I would not go below 1.5 joules for a multi-species operation.

Grounding Requirements
The Zareba 50 Mile wants three 6-foot galvanized ground rods spaced 10 feet apart. I drove the first two in clay soil with no trouble, but the third took a sledgehammer and a water hose. Once installed, the system read a clean 0.3 ohms to ground, and the fence sang. Skimping on grounding is the #1 reason chargers underperform, and this one rewards the effort.
Build Quality and Durability
The cabinet is heavy-gauge plastic with a solid transformer inside. After 90 days outside, including a hailstorm, the housing shows no cracks. The indicator light is small and recessed, which is good for weather but bad for checking status from 20 feet away. I solved this by adding a $4 reflective marker tape on top of the case.

How to Choose the Right Electric Fence Charger for Your Property
The right electric fence charger depends on four factors: the animals you are containing, the total length of your fence, the vegetation load, and whether you have AC power. I have seen too many buyers undersize their charger and end up replacing it within a year. Buy one size larger than you think you need, and you will avoid that cycle.
Joule Output Requirements by Animal Type
The joule is the unit of energy delivered per pulse. Higher joules mean a stronger shock that cuts through vegetation and reaches animals with thick hair or wool. Here is the joule range that works for each animal type based on my testing and industry guidance:
- 0.1 joule – Pet containment (dogs, cats), small garden protection from rabbits and raccoons. Suitable for clean, short fences under 1 mile.
- 0.25 to 0.5 joule – Small livestock on clean fences (goats, sheep, mini horses), single-strand horse tape. Best for properties under 5 acres.
- 1 to 2 joules – Standard livestock work (cattle, horses, pigs, goats on multi-strand fences). Handles light to moderate vegetation. The sweet spot for most small farms.
- 2 to 5 joules – Large properties, heavy vegetation, multi-species operations, rotational grazing with portable fences. Use when fence length exceeds 10 miles or weed pressure is constant.
- 6+ joules – Predator exclusion (wolves, bears), long-distance perimeter fencing (20+ miles), and high-voltage systems for deer exclusion in crop protection.
The general rule from my own testing and from the experienced users on homesteading forums: bigger is better. If your fence is 1 mile long, buy a charger rated for 3-5 miles. The headroom matters because chargers running at their limit lose voltage to every weed and every wet day.
AC vs Battery vs Solar Power Source
AC (plug-in) chargers are the most reliable and the most powerful for the price. If you have a 110V outlet within 100 feet of your fence, AC is the default choice. The downsides are the need for a covered outlet and the risk of lightning damage if not properly grounded.
Battery-powered chargers (12V DC with a deep-cycle marine battery) are portable and work in remote locations. They require regular battery maintenance and replacement every 3-5 years. Solar chargers are a subset of battery chargers with a built-in panel.
Solar chargers have improved significantly in the last five years. The best modern units (Gallagher S12, Zareba ESP5M-Z, ANDMON MINI400) can run 10-14 days without direct sun. The downsides are higher upfront cost and the need for a 2-3 day initial charge. Solar is the right choice for remote pastures with no AC power, rotational grazing setups, and off-grid properties.
Mileage Ratings vs Real-World Coverage
Manufacturer mileage ratings are always best-case: clean, single-strand wire, no vegetation, perfect grounding. The real-world range is often 30-50% of the rating, especially with weed pressure. Zareba is one of the few brands that publishes both an ideal and a heavy-weed rating on the same product page. The Zareba 50 Mile, for example, is rated for 50 miles ideal, 25 miles in light weeds, and 12 miles in heavy weeds.
The multi-wire formula from Zareba is useful here. If you have a 3-strand fence, divide the single-strand mileage rating by 3. A charger rated for 30 miles of single wire will power about 10 miles of 3-strand fence under the same conditions. This is one of the most common sources of undersizing in real installations.
Low Impedance vs Standard Chargers
Low-impedance chargers are designed to handle vegetation contact without bleeding all their energy to the ground. They use a different transformer design that maintains voltage even when weeds touch the wire. Every charger in this roundup is low-impedance, and that is the standard you should insist on.
Older non-impedance chargers (sometimes called “weed-burner” chargers) are still sold for very short fences in clean conditions. They are cheaper but they fail the moment vegetation grows. For anything beyond a small pet fence, low-impedance is mandatory.
Grounding and Lightning Protection
Grounding is the #1 cause of weak fence performance. A charger that delivers 6,000 volts will read as 3,000 volts on the fence if the ground system is poor. Here is the rule: use 6-foot galvanized ground rods, drive them all the way in, space them 10 feet apart, and use as many as the manufacturer recommends (usually 1-3 for small units, 3+ for high-output chargers).
Lightning protection is built into most modern chargers, but it only works if the surge diverter is properly grounded. A direct strike will still destroy most units, but the diverter routes a nearby strike to ground instead of through the transformer. For high-risk areas, add a separate lightning diverter on the fence line within 50 feet of the charger.
For a comprehensive grounding guide, the Zareba educational content is the best free resource in the industry. We referenced their multi-wire formula and grounding depth recommendations throughout this guide.
Frequently Asked Questions
How many joules is a good electric fence charger?
A good electric fence charger delivers 0.5 to 2 joules for most small-farm livestock work. Use 0.1 joule for pet containment, 0.25 to 0.5 joule for small livestock on clean fences, 1 to 2 joules for cattle, horses, and pigs on multi-strand fences, and 2 to 5 joules for large properties or heavy vegetation. Bigger is better: if your fence is 1 mile, buy a charger rated for 3-5 miles so the unit is not running at its limit.
What size electric fence charger do I need for 2 acres?
For 2 acres, a 0.5 to 1 joule charger is the right size. A 2-acre square perimeter is about 0.18 miles of single-strand fence, so a charger rated for 2-5 miles will have plenty of headroom. The Zareba 10 Mile (0.5 joule) or the Patriot PE2 (0.1 joule, for pet-only use) are good fits. For multi-strand fences, divide the single-strand rating by the number of strands to find the real-world coverage.
Can an electric fence charger be too powerful?
An electric fence charger can be overpowered for a small fence, but it will not harm the animals. The shock from a high-joule charger on a short fence is no stronger than the same charger on a long fence because the pulse is regulated. The downside of oversizing is cost: you pay for capacity you do not need. The bigger risk is undersizing, which results in a fence that animals learn to challenge and breach.
Can the ground be too dry for an electric fence to work?
Yes, dry ground is one of the most common causes of weak fence performance. The shock circuit requires the animal to complete a path to ground, and dry soil is a poor conductor. In arid conditions or during summer drought, you may need to water your ground rods or add more rods. Some high-output chargers (2+ joules) handle dry ground better because the higher voltage pushes current through resistant soil.
How long do electric fence chargers usually last?
A well-maintained electric fence charger lasts 5 to 10 years on average, and premium brands like Gallagher, Zareba, and Parmak can run 10+ years. Solar chargers with internal batteries have a shorter lifespan because the battery needs replacement every 3-5 years. Lightning damage is the most common cause of early failure, which is why proper grounding and surge protection matter. Brands that honor lightning damage in their warranty (Zareba, Gallagher) give you a safety net.
